About Kumar V. Jata

Kumar V. Jata is a scholar working on Mechanical Engineering, Mechanics of Materials, Aerospace Engineering, Materials Chemistry and Civil and Structural Engineering, having authored 70 papers that have together received 2.9k indexed citations. Recurring topics across this work include Aluminum Alloy Microstructure Properties (23 papers), Ultrasonics and Acoustic Wave Propagation (20 papers), Aluminum Alloys Composites Properties (18 papers), Structural Health Monitoring Techniques (13 papers), Microstructure and mechanical properties (10 papers), Non-Destructive Testing Techniques (10 papers), Advanced Welding Techniques Analysis (10 papers) and Fatigue and fracture mechanics (9 papers). The work is most often cited by research in Mechanical Engineering (2.3k citations), Aerospace Engineering (1.3k citations), Metals and Alloys (133 citations), Mechanics of Materials (992 citations) and Civil and Structural Engineering (354 citations). Kumar V. Jata has collaborated with scholars based in United States, Switzerland and United Kingdom. Frequent co-authors include S. L. Semiatin, Krishnan K. Sankaran, J.J. Ruschau, Tribikram Kundu, E. A. Starke, Samik Das, Tracy W. Nelson, David P. Field, Yuri Hovanski and Steven Martin. Their work appears in journals such as Materials Science and Engineering A, Metallurgical Transactions A, Metallurgical and Materials Transactions A, Structural Health Monitoring and The Journal of the Acoustical Society of America.
